Website: www.sjgov.org/ehd Mike Huggins,REHS,RDI <br /> Phone: (209) 468-3420 Margaret Lagorio,REHS <br /> Robert McClellon, REHS <br /> January 9, 2009 Fax: (209) 464-0138 ,teff Carruesco,REHS, RDI <br /> Kasey Foley,REHS <br /> Johnson Petroleum Construction, Inc. <br /> P.O.Box 7169 <br /> Auburn, CA 95604 <br /> RE: City of Stockton Redevelopment Dept.,701 W.Weber Ave., Stockton CA <br /> The permit application(SR0056275)to remove two underground storage tanks(UST)039- <br /> 0517737 and 039-0517738,associated piping and other appurtenances from the above referenced <br /> facility has been approved with the following conditions: <br /> 1. If the backfill material and soil is found to be contaminated it must be disposed of at an <br /> approved disposal location. Treatment of soil onsite can only be performed under a hazardous <br /> waste treatment permit. <br /> 2. A copy of the"Site Health& Safety Plan"must be on the jobsite for review. <br /> 3. See pages 7& 8 of the permit application for required analytical tests and number of samples <br /> to be taken and witnessed by this department. Form EH 23 046 Revised 07/31/08 must be <br /> utilized. <br /> 4. A copy of the fire department permit must be submitted at the time of removal. <br /> 5. In addition,the following information must be submitted within 30 days after the UST <br /> removal date: <br /> (a) Only analytical results that come directly from a third party California certified <br /> laboratory with affixed chain of custody will be accepted by this office. <br /> (b) UST Tracking Record Sheet and/or Tank Hazardous Waste Manifest. <br /> (c) Tank Closure Certification Form(DTSC form 1249). <br /> (d) Hazardous Waste Manifest for piping,rinsate, residual fuel, or waste oil receipt. <br /> 6. This permit expires 180 days from the approval date. <br /> 7. Schedule the removal inspection at least 48 hours in advance. <br /> If you have any questions please contact Ray von Flue at(209)468-9848. <br /> Thank you, <br /> `lyjs � <br /> Ray von Flue,REHS <br /> Senior Registered Environmental Health Specialist <br />
